Judge Garland: Guatanomo detainees may not assert habeas rights

From back in 2003.  (The late Justice Scalia did better in a similar case.)  Obama has never been very interested in the Supreme Court, i.e., he has never been intent on reshaping it into the liberal analogue of Scalia's court, so it is not surprising that he has chosen a "path of least (potential) resistance" nominee, who will be more like Justice Kennedy or Justice Breyer than like Justice Alito on the right or the late Justice Brennan on the "left."
